If goods are faulty, whether bought in-store or online, you are entitled to a full refund provided you haven't 'accepted them'. In a nutshell, this means you have had time to inspect the goods and reject them.
If you simply change your mind, the retailer has no legal obligation to give you your money back, should you return an item without a receipt. ... If your goods are faulty, and you don't have the receipt, you still have the right to a repair, refund or replacement as under the Consumer Rights Act.
A refund means the retailer returns the money you paid for faulty goods. If you originally paid for the goods on a credit or debit card, the retailer may refund the credit or debit card instead of giving cash. If your consumer complaint is valid a retailer cannot insist on giving you a credit note instead of a refund.
If you're having problems and the shop won't refund, repair or replace your goods, then you should report it to your local trading standards department, as the retailer is breaching your statutory rights. It's worth telling the shop that you're going to do this, as it could mean your complaint is then dealt with.
A warranty is a type of guarantee that a manufacturer or similar party makes regarding the condition of its product. It also refers to the terms and situations in which repairs or exchanges will be made in the event that the product does not function as originally described or intended.
With a full warranty, a company guarantees to repair or replace a faulty product during the warranty period. If the product is damaged or defective, companies offering a full warranty must repair or replace it within a reasonable time. ... A limited warranty might cover only specific parts or certain types of defects.
